app developmentmobilefreelanceinvoicing tips

Rechnungsstellung als App-Entwickler: Saetze, Konditionen und Vorlagen

Rechnungsstellung fuer App-Entwickler: Sprint- und Meilenstein-Saetze, Zahlungsplaene, Store- und API-Kosten auf Rechnungen, Fehler und eine App-Entwickler-Vorlage.

InvoiceQuickly Team··Aktualisiert ·6 min read

Kurzfassung: Strukturieren Sie App-Entwicklungsrechnungen um Sprints oder Meilensteine, die an vorzeigbare Builds gebunden sind, trennen Sie plattformspezifische Arbeit (iOS, Android, Backend) in jeder Zeile, leiten Sie Store-Gebuehren und Cloud-Kosten transparent weiter, und rechnen Sie alle zwei Wochen oder pro Meilenstein ab, um den Cashflow mit der Lieferung abzugleichen.

Mobile- und Backend-Arbeit profitiert von Rechnungen, die Ihren Backlog widerspiegeln: Epics, Sprints oder feste Phasen fuer MVP → v1 → Feinschliff. Das hilft Gruendern, Ausgaben dem Runway zuzuordnen, und Enterprise-PMs, PO-Positionen abzugleichen.

TestFlight-Builds, Store-Screenshots und Analytics sind leicht zu verschenken — setzen Sie sie in Scope-Dokumente und Rechnungspositionen, wenn sie nicht kostenlos sind. Backend-API-Arbeit und Mobile-UI sollten trennbare Positionen sein, wenn verschiedene Sponsoren fuer jeden Track bezahlen. Wear OS oder Apple Watch-Companions werden leicht unterschaetzt — wenn Sie sie bepreist haben, listen Sie die Plattform explizit, damit niemand denkt, "iOS-App" haette jede Bildschirmgroesse standardmaessig eingeschlossen.

Typische Saetze

Time and Materials mit einer Nicht-ueberschreiten-Obergrenze, Festpreis-Meilensteine oder monatliche Team-Retainer sind gaengig. Apple-/Google-Entwicklergebuehren und Cloud-Nutzung koennen Durchlaufposten oder mit Aufschlag sein — geben Sie Ihre Richtlinie an. Fuer Release-Prozess-Kontext, der Zeitplaene beeinflusst, siehe Apples App Store Review Guidelines zur Erklaerung von Ablehnungszyklen auf Rechnungen oder Leistungsbeschreibungen.

Stundenbasiertes T&M (100-200 $+ je nach Stack und Markt) eignet sich fuer laufende Feature-Entwicklung und Bugfix-Auftraege. Festpreis-Meilensteine passen fuer MVP-Builds, bei denen der Umfang in einem Produktanforderungsdokument definiert ist. Sprint-basierte Abrechnung (alle zwei Wochen) passt zu agilen Workflows und haelt beide Seiten bei der Velocity ehrlich. Monatliche Retainer (5.000-20.000 $+) eignen sich fuer laufende Produktentwicklung, bei der Sie als fraktionaler CTO oder eingebetteter Entwickler fungieren.

Erhoehen Sie Saetze, wenn Sie Plattformspezialisierung entwickeln (React Native Cross-Platform, SwiftUI nativ, Flutter), wenn Sie App-Store-Erfolgsmetriken vorweisen koennen (Downloads, Bewertungen, Retention) oder wenn Ihre Pipeline durchgehend gebucht ist. Entwickler mit DevOps- und CI/CD-Faehigkeiten erzielen Aufschlaege, weil sie den Bedarf des Kunden an einer separaten Ops-Einstellung reduzieren.

Security-Review oder Penetrationstest-Behebungsbloecke sollten separate Meilensteine sein, damit die Zahlung nicht von Zeitplaenen Dritter abhaengt, die Sie nicht kontrollieren. CI/CD-Minuten und Device-Farm-Nutzung steigen kurz vor dem Launch — entweder enthaltene Nutzung deckeln oder Mehrverbrauch abrechnen. Offline-First oder sync-intensive Features verdienen explizite QA-Positionen — sie sind nicht "einfach ein weiterer Screen", wenn Regressionstests sich verdoppeln. Push-Notification- und Deep-Link-Plumbing erstreckt sich oft ueber Mobile und Backend — teilen Sie die Stunden ehrlich auf, damit jeder Team-Lead sieht, was er finanziert.

Beispiel-Rechnungspositionen

BeschreibungMengeSatzBetrag
Sprint 3 -- Benutzerauthentifizierung und Profilscreens (iOS + Android)2 Wochen8.000 $ pauschal8.000,00 $
Backend-API -- Zahlungsintegration (Stripe Connect, Webhooks)1 Meilenstein4.500 $ pauschal4.500,00 $
QA und Geraetetests -- Regressionssuite, 6-Geraete-Matrix12 Std.125 $/Std.1.500,00 $
App-Store-Einreichung und Review-Management (iOS + Google Play)1500 $ pauschal500,00 $
Cloud-Hosting -- AWS (EC2, RDS, S3) monatliche Nutzung1 MonatDurchlaufposten287,40 $
Apple Developer Program -- Jahresgebuehr (anteilig)1Durchlaufposten99,00 $

Wann die Rechnung senden

Fuer sprintbasierte Entwicklung stellen Sie am Ende jedes Sprints (alle zwei Wochen) eine Rechnung, nach der Demo oder dem Sprint-Review. Die Verknuepfung der Rechnung mit einem vorzeigbaren Build gibt dem Kunden ein konkretes Lieferobjekt zum Abgleich mit der Berechnung.

Bei Festpreis-MVP-Projekten rechnen Sie pro Meilenstein ab: typischerweise 30 % bei Projektstart, 40 % bei Beta-Build, 30 % bei App-Store-Einreichung. Passen Sie die Aufteilung basierend auf dem Projektrisiko an — hoehere Vorauszahlungen sind angemessen fuer Neukunden ohne Erfolgsbilanz.

Fuer laufende Retainer und Support stellen Sie am Monatsanfang eine Rechnung mit einer Zusammenfassung der geschlossenen Tickets, ausgelieferten Features und genutzten Stunden. Wenn der Retainer ein Stundenkontingent enthaelt, zeigen Sie Nutzung und verbleibendes Guthaben.

Zahlungsbedingungen

Vorauszahlung fuer Sprint 1, dann alle 2 Wochen oder pro Meilenstein; Netto 30 fuer unterschriebene B2B-Vertraege. Einbehalte selten, es sei denn, der Enterprise-Einkauf verlangt sie — spiegeln Sie deren Wortlaut. Fuer Festpreis-MVPs binden Sie 30/40/30-Aufteilungen an vorzeigbare Builds, nicht nur an Kalendermonate. Siehe Rechnungszahlungsbedingungen.

Was enthalten sein sollte

Release- oder Sprint-ID, Features oder Tickets zusammengefasst (lesbar fuer Nicht-Techniker), Stunden Ă— Satz oder pauschale Sprint-Gebuehr, Drittanbieter-Kosten aufgeschluesselt, Tests/QA wenn separat abgerechnet, Steuer, Gesamtbetrag, Faelligkeitsdatum. Ueberpruefen Sie universelle Felder ueber was auf eine Rechnung gehoert.

Vermerken Sie Plattform (iOS, Android, Backend) in jeder Zeile, wenn ein Stakeholder nur die Haelfte des Stacks interessiert. Build-Nummer oder Tag-Referenzen helfen QA und Finanzabteilung, dasselbe Release zuzuordnen.

Haeufige Fehler

Einzelne Zeile "Entwicklung" fuer 20.000 $ — Finanzabteilungen lehnen ab. Scope Creep ohne Nachtraege. Store-Einreichung als enthalten angenommen — berechnen Sie explizit, wenn Sie das Release-Management uebernehmen. Waehrungsfehler bei globalen Kunden — geben Sie die Waehrung in jeder Zeile an. Crashlytics- oder Observability-Kosten stillschweigend absorbiert — entweder in den Retainer einbuendeln oder transparent abrechnen. OWASP-Fixes unter "Bugs" versteckt, obwohl sie Sicherheits-Scope waren — kennzeichnen Sie sie fuer Audit-Trails. Feature Flags und Remote Config-Arbeit unter "Feinschliff" versteckt — sie sind Infrastruktur mit laufenden Kosten; zeigen Sie sie bei der Setup-Abrechnung. App-Store-Screenshot- oder Vorschauvideo-Produktion ist Marketingarbeit — entweder explizit in einem Paket einschliessen oder separat abrechnen.

Keine Trennung von Store-Ablehnungs-Nacharbeit und normaler Entwicklung — wenn Apple den Build ablehnt und Sie 8 Stunden fuer Compliance-Korrekturen aufwenden, ist das entweder durch Ihre Einreichungsmanagement-Position abgedeckt oder als zusaetzlicher Umfang abzurechnen; Mehrdeutigkeit hier untergaebt Vertrauen. Backend-Infrastrukturkosten, die still wachsen ohne Kundenbewusstsein — senden Sie eine monatliche Cloud-Kostenuebersicht, auch wenn Sie sie im Retainer absorbieren; Ueberraschungen bei der Verlaengerung toeten Vertraege. Fehlende Build-Nummer oder Versions-Tag auf jeder Rechnung — Engineering und Finanzen muessen die Rechnung einem bestimmten Release zuordnen koennen; "Sprint 4 Entwicklung" ohne Versionsreferenz ist nicht pruefbar.

FAQ

Sollte ich fuer App-Store-Einreichung und Review-Management abrechnen? Ja. Die Verwaltung des Einreichungsprozesses — Archiv erstellen, Release Notes schreiben, Screenshots verwalten, Pruefer-Fragen beantworten und Ablehnungszyklen managen — ist echte Arbeit. Berechnen Sie es als Pauschale pro Einreichung oder als benannte Position in Ihrem Meilenstein. Kunden, die annehmen, "App bauen" schliesst unendliche Store-Einreichungen ein, werden Ihre Zeit erschoepfen.

Wie gehe ich mit Cloud-Kosten um, die monatlich schwanken? Leiten Sie tatsaechliche Cloud-Kosten mit Beleg oder Cost-Explorer-Screenshot weiter. Wenn Sie Planbarkeit bevorzugen, legen Sie im Vertrag ein monatliches Cloud-Budget fest und berechnen einen Pauschalbetrag, mit Mehrverbrauch zum Selbstkostenpreis. Zeigen Sie in jedem Fall die Cloud-Position separat von der Entwicklungsarbeit, damit der Kunde versteht, dass Infrastruktur eine laufende Verpflichtung ist.

Wie rechne ich am besten mit einem Startup mit begrenztem Runway ab? Nutzen Sie meilensteinbasierte Abrechnung gebunden an vorzeigbare Builds, damit der Gruender Ausgaben direkt dem Fortschritt zuordnen kann. Vermeiden Sie Netto 30 bei Early-Stage-Startups — kassieren Sie vor oder bei jedem Meilenstein. Wenn dem Startup mitten im Projekt das Geld ausgeht, bedeutet Meilenstein-Abrechnung, dass Sie fuer alles bezahlt wurden, was Sie bisher geliefert haben.

Nutzen Sie die App-Entwickler-Rechnungsvorlage fuer Meilenstein- und technische Einzelpositionen.

Speichern Sie Sprint-Zusammenfassungsschnipsel aus Ihrem PM-Tool als Rechnungsmemos, um Copy-Paste-Fehler zu reduzieren.


Frueher Zugang beitreten, um App-Arbeit ohne Vorlagenmueudigkeit abzurechnen.

Kostenlose Rechnungs-Checkliste

Laden Sie unsere 15-Punkte-Checkliste herunter, um sicherzustellen, dass jede Rechnung vollständig, professionell und steuerkonform ist.

Kostenloses PDF, kein Spam. Jederzeit abbestellbar.

Rechnungstipps, die wirklich helfen

SchlieĂźen Sie sich ĂĽber 5.000 Freiberuflern und Kleinunternehmern an. Eine E-Mail pro Woche mit praktischen Rechnungstipps, Steuertipps und Produktneuheiten.

Kein Spam, niemals. Jederzeit abbestellbar.

Rechnungsstellung als App-Entwickler: Saetze, Konditionen und Vorlagen